Transaction fb6c883da260485e4e8756156be238aef85ac0e8a4f250b6867af3df51031f92
1 Input
1 Output
-
fb6c883da260485e4e8756156be238aef85ac0e8a4f250b6867af3df51031f92:0
- value
- 435576
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bd57e84249aac7b317f4fbcf5bb9ca196327a53
- address
- bc1qh02happyn2k8kvtlf770twuu5xtry7jn8676cr